webview的两种progressbar

该博客介绍了在Android中使用WebView时,如何通过两种不同的方法实现进度条效果。第一种是在Activity中直接设置简单的布局;第二种是利用ImageView或ImageButton结合动画实现图形旋转的进度效果。通过XML动画文件控制图片旋转,并在WebView的onPageStarted和onPageFinished方法中启动和停止动画,以显示网页加载的状态。
摘要由CSDN通过智能技术生成

<p>我上一个项目在需要加载webview , 而webview加载网页的方法我们都是知道的loadURL方法和loaddata方法,这里就不说这些。</p><p>现在我要说的是,在webview加载网页如果没有进度条也就是progressbar是一个很别扭的事情,而现在最常见的两种进度条:一种为线条形状的进度条,一种是圆形旋转的进度条,我现在就详细说下这两个进度条:</p><p>线条形状的进度条:</p><p><span style="white-space: pre;">	</span>我的方法是重写一个webview,在webview上直接的增加progressbar,</p><p>直接上代码:</p>


package com.example.integral.utils;

import android.content.Context;
import android.graphics.Color;
import android.util.AttributeSet;
import android.view.WindowManager.LayoutParams;
import android.webkit.WebView;
import android.widget.ProgressBar;

/**
 * 带进度条的WebView
 * 
 */
@SuppressWarnings("deprecation")
public cla
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值